What Are Relics and Artifacts in Anime Destiny?

In Anime Destiny, progress is determined by more than just the raw level of your units. While leveling up and evolving your characters provides a massive baseline boost, endgame content requires extra optimization. This is where Anime Destiny artifacts come into play.

Officially labeled as "Relics" in the game's user interface, these equippable items grant global passive buffs to your deployed units. Unlike standard unit upgrades, these items apply global or localized stat boosts such as increased range, attack speed, and raw damage output. These scaling factors become mandatory when facing high-health bosses in the late-game stages.


The Fate of Destiny Mode: Your Artifact Farming Hub

To obtain these game-changing Anime Destiny artifacts, players must participate in the Fate of Destiny mode. This specialized game mode consists of 15 waves of increasingly difficult enemies. While it functions similarly to standard story maps, the rewards are entirely unique.

Completing these stages grants you access to exclusive relics. Additionally, Fate of Destiny serves as an excellent source of daily rerolls. Players can earn up to 25 rerolls per stage daily, totaling 100 rerolls if you clear all four main sectors.

Fate of Destiny Stage Breakdown

Below is a detailed breakdown of the current Fate of Destiny stages, their associated artifact rewards, and daily limits:

Stage NameWave CountPrimary Relic / Artifact RewardDaily Reroll LimitRecommended Player Level
Namek15 WavesBeginner's Relic (+11% Range, +25% Damage)25 RerollsLevel 1+
Nimbus15 WavesCloud Relic (Speed & Utility Buffs)25 RerollsLevel 20+
Marine Outpost15 WavesFleet Relic (Tactical Damage Multipliers)25 RerollsLevel 40+
Iron Wolf District15 WavesIron Relic (Defense Penetration & Crit)25 RerollsLevel 60+

Anime Destiny Artifacts Tier List & Stat Buffs

Not all relics are created equal. Some provide niche utility buffs, while others completely transform your offensive capabilities. According to player experiences, prioritizing specific Anime Destiny artifacts can completely trivialize late-game bosses like Igris and Ymir.

By equipping top-tier Anime Destiny artifacts, you can push through infinite modes and high-difficulty legend stages with ease. This table highlights how different Anime Destiny artifacts scale your overall team power:

Artifact / Relic NameTierStat Buffs ProvidedPrimary Use CaseObtainability
First Destiny RelicS-Tier+11% Range, +25% DamageUniversal DPS & Range BoostNamek Fate of Destiny
Iron Wolf RelicS-Tier+15% Critical Chance, +20% Critical DamagePhysical & Crit-heavy DPS UnitsIron Wolf Fate of Destiny
Nimbus Cloud RelicA-Tier+10% Attack Speed, +5% Movement SlowCrowd Control & Support UnitsNimbus Fate of Destiny
Marine Outpost RelicB-Tier+15% Damage to Bosses, +5% RangeBoss-only DPS OptimizationMarine Outpost Fate of Destiny

Key Synergies Explained

  • Zoro & Bleed Damage: Zoro is a staple for boss modes like Ymir and Igris. His bleed effect completely halts enemy health regeneration. Amplifying his range with the First Destiny Relic ensures he applies bleed to fast-moving bosses much earlier on the track.
  • Shanks & Time Stop: Shanks possesses a massive circle AoE and a time-stop mechanic. Boosting his attack speed via the Nimbus Cloud Relic allows him to cycle his time-stop ability much faster, keeping enemies permanently locked in place.
  • Shadow Monarch & Summons: Since his summons scale directly off his personal damage output, giving him raw damage relics maximizes the health and damage of his shadow army.

Advanced Progression & Co-op Farming Strategies

If you are struggling to clear the Legend Stages for evolution items or the Fate of Destiny for relics, do not play solo. Anime Destiny features incredibly generous co-op scaling.

Community reports show that the enemy health scaling factor is only about 0.25 per additional player. This means adding a second player only increases a boss's health by roughly 25,000 HP, while doubling your team's total damage output.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get more Anime Destiny artifacts daily?

You can farm relics and artifacts by completing the Fate of Destiny game mode. Each of the four distinct sectors (Namek, Nimbus, Marine Outpost, and Iron Wolf District) rewards unique relics and offers a daily limit of 25 rerolls, allowing you to acquire up to 100 total rerolls per day.

Do Anime Destiny artifacts apply to all units in my loadout?

Yes, most relics and artifacts provide global passive buffs that apply to all units deployed on your field. Certain artifacts may target specific attributes, such as boosting range or critical strike chance, which naturally benefit high-DPS units more than support or farm units.

What is the difference between relics and artifacts in the game?

They are the same mechanic. The community and player base frequently refer to these equippable stat-boosting items as "Anime Destiny artifacts," while the official in-game menu and UI label them as "Relics."

Which mythic units should I focus on evolving first?

Trunks and Beerus are the easiest mythic units to evolve early on, as their evolution items drop from the first acts of the Legend Stages with a high 25% success rate. For the late game, focus on evolving Zoro and Shanks to tackle the hardest boss modes.
